SerialPortError()
Syntaxe
Resultat = SerialPortError(#PortSerie)Description
Renvoie l'erreur qui est survenue après ReadSerialPortData(), WriteSerialPortData() ou WriteSerialPortString().
Arguments
#PortSerie Le port série à utiliser.
Valeur de retour
Peut être une combinaison des valeurs suivantes:#PB_SerialPort_RxOver : Un dépassement est survenu dans le tampon d'entrée (Il n'y a plus de place dans le tampon d'entrée ou un caractère a été reçu apres un 'fin-de-fichier' (EOF)). #PB_SerialPort_OverRun : Un dépassement est survenu dans le tampon des caractères. Le prochain caractère est perdu. #PB_SerialPort_RxParity : Le système a détecté une erreur de parité. #PB_SerialPort_Frame : Le système a détecté une erreur d'encapsulation des données. #PB_SerialPort_Break : Le système a détecté une condition d'arrêt. #PB_SerialPort_TxFull : L'application a essayé d'envoyer un caractère mais le tampon de sortie est plein. #PB_SerialPort_IOE : Une erreur d'Entrée/Sortie est survenue. #PB_SerialPort_WaitingCTS : Indique que le système attend le signal CTS (clear-to-send) avant d'émettre. #PB_SerialPort_WaitingDSR : Indique que le système attend le signal DSR (data-set-ready) avant d'émettre. #PB_SerialPort_WaitingRLSD : Indique que le système attend le signal RLSD (receive-line-signal-detect) avant d'émettre. #PB_SerialPort_XoffReceived: Indique que le système est en attente car le caractère XOFF a été reçu. #PB_SerialPort_XoffSent : Indique que le système est en attente car le caractère XOFF a été transmis. La transmission s'arrête quand le caractère XOFF est émis à un système qui attend le caractère XON. #PB_SerialPort_EOFSent : Indique que le caractère 'fin-de-fichier' (EOF) a été reçu.
Voir aussi
ReadSerialPortData(), WriteSerialPortData(), WriteSerialPortString()
OS Supportés
Tous